http://espn.go.com/nfl/story/_/id/7959267/washington-redskins-dallas-cowboys-cap-penalty-appeals-denied The Redskins and Cowboys appealed the $36M and $10M penalties, respectively, against their salary caps for overloading contracts during the uncapped 2010 season. Today, a league arbitrator denied those appeals. This means that the Redskins will go forward for two years having with a salary cap that is $18M lower than the rest of the league.
